Eligibility and Registration Process for Military Certification Exams

Getting set for a military certification exam starts with meeting the specific requirements for your branch. You’ll need to have the right rank, service branch, or MOS-related prerequisites, and be ready to show IDs, transcripts, or service records. These documents tell the exam board that you’re prepared for the challenge ahead and ready to serve in your role.
Here’s a simple, step-by-step checklist to help you register:
- Check that you meet your branch’s specific requirements.
- Collect necessary IDs, transcripts, or service records.
- Head to the official website and open the online registration portal using the military entrance exam guide.
- Pick the exam type, date, and location.
- Complete your payment or secure a waiver for the exam fees.
- Get your seating assignment and exam login details.
Remember, exam scheduling deadlines are firm, so be sure to review the rescheduling policies if you need to change your exam date. The online system is built to handle changes but acting fast is crucial to lock in your preferred exam slot.

Cognitive Strategy Techniques
When you face a question, start by crossing out answers that just don’t seem right. This simple move clears the field so you can focus on the correct answer faster. Set a timer for each question to help you move along without spending too much time on one. It also helps to run through some quick-thinking drills as you review your study guides, like mini field exercises that sharpen your decision-making skills. Don’t forget to highlight key words in each question; these hints can guide you straight to the right answer. Using these tactics can really boost your score and accuracy when time is tight.
Stress Management During Certification
Stay cool on exam day. If you start feeling anxious, take a few deep breaths to reset your focus. A good night’s sleep and a healthy meal before the test will give you the steady energy you need for those long hours. Stick to your pre-exam routine, a few minutes of meditation or a brisk walk can melt away any lingering tension. Sometimes a quick mental reset, like remembering a positive study moment, can help keep your stress levels low and your mind sharp for every question.
